Product details

Rust protection paint for all uncoated, rusted, or previously painted ferrous metals and non-ferrous metals after appropriate pre-treatment, such as garden fences, garden furniture, stair and balcony railings, window grilles, lamps, bicycles, trellises, etc.

Hammerite paints are generally not suitable for painting motor vehicles, tempered surfaces (such as grills, oven pipes, brake calipers, engines, exhaust systems, etc.), surfaces exposed to high mechanical stress (such as floors, lifting platforms, vehicle underbodies, etc.), powder-coated objects, or components with permanent underwater contact (such as swimming pool ladders, in boat areas, dishwasher baskets, aquariums, etc.).

Preparation:
Uncoated ferrous metals: Sand very smooth surfaces. Remove sanding dust. Clean the surface very carefully with Hammerite Metal Cleaner.

Rusted ferrous metals: Remove loose particles with a wire brush. Clean the surface with Hammerite Metal Cleaner.

Cast iron: Remove loose particles, sand, and clean with Hammerite Metal Cleaner. Apply a layer of Hammerite Rust Blocker as an adhesion promoter.

Tip: The hammer effect is best achieved when the paint is applied quickly and not too thinly, allowing time for the effect to develop. Repeated touch-ups or brushing of the paint can result in a less pronounced hammer effect. Hammered paints can only be touched up with hammered paints. Using other systems may lead to adhesion or surface defects.
